In this calculation, the total width of both PMGs is a variable parameter with a fixed
height of 30 mm and a fixed width ratio of 1. Fig. 7.24 shows the changing curve of
the levitation forces at positions of 5, 10, 15, and 20 mm above Rail_A and Rail_B with
the growth of the total width from 60 to 170 mm. These figures show that with the
increase of the position, the total width where the MLF appears is shifted from small
to large value, e.g. the levitation forces increase almost linearly with the total width
